I have a 2006 FLHX with a removable tour pack. I know that my 2009 police roadking has a newer frame diagnosed and things are not meant to interchange, that being said, how difficult would it be to adapt something so that there would be docking hardware on my 2009 that would fit my tour-pack?

I believe the only requirement is the 4 point docking hardware kit (54205-09A) and tour pack mount(53276-09B), then bolt your TP onto the mount.

It will not work from bike to bike without a new, '09 -later tour pak bracket and mount hardwear. I tried doing the same thing. I have an '05 RG and a '11RG You'll probably need to pick one of the bikes for the tour pac, either that or buy 2 seperates complete tour pak for each bike. I chose to use the tour pak on the '11 but only when I travel and turned the '05 into my around town bike.
